The greatest hoax on earth

Is this science?

THE GREATEST HOAX ON EARTH
Refuting Dawkins on evolution
By Jonathan Safarti
Creation Book Publishers. 333 pages
ISBN 978-1-92164-306-4

According to the author, the Bible is a scientific textbook that precludes the possibilities of ‘deep time’, an ancient universe and the existence of a unified explanation for the origins of biological diversity. So those who have inferred these conclusions from empirical research are victims of a gigantic hoax or conspiracy, as the title proposes.

Superficially, it appears that these issues are being addressed by a bona fide member of the scientific community. However, notwithstanding the author’s science PhD, his original scientific output is restricted to co-authorship of five competent papers from the period 1988-1995. But then — as now — this would have been insufficient for him to secure appointment as a junior lecturer at a ‘Russell Group’ university. Even more so, Jonathan Sarfati is patently unwilling to exhibit the traits of authentic open-minded scientific mentality. Where is the fearless and creative engagement with the world of science and scholarship that is characteristic of the best of Christian thought down the centuries? Its absence is enough to make the angels weep.

Yet again, the superficial impression is given that the work is one of true scholarship, as indicated by the mass of footnotes. Some of these are very good, but there is a strong preference for citing authors of similar persuasion. Given that this is intended as a teaching exercise for the Christian public, I hoped for a reference in chapter 11 to at least one accessible work setting out the evidence for earth’s antiquity — for example: Matthew Hedman, The Age of Everything: How science explores the past (2008).

The author’s outlook directs him to a Procrustean methodology that will only countenance evidence that appears to fit his truncated worldview. The remainder is chopped off and dismissed. Hence, despite wide reading and discussion, his general conclusions are viciously circular and entirely predictable. So his approach lacks all conviction as an even-handed assessment of evidence. Despite this, the work is clearly written and well structured. As a Calvinist, I must admit that — as with the works of the heathen — his efforts are not entirely without profit.

Of course, a major target is Richard Dawkins and especially his book The Greatest Show on Earth. Generally, though not particularly in that book, Dawkins is such a gift to the Christian apologist! However, it does not follow that everything that Dawkins says is automatically erroneous. After all, Professor Dawkins actually lives in the same universe as us — created and controlled by God. Given his passion for exploration of that world, it would be astonishing if he did not highlight many things that are good, true and beautiful. Sadly, Dawkins is spiritually blind — which Safarti, by divine grace, is not. So here is a work by a genuine Christian brother, who, I conclude nevertheless, is misguided and misguiding. Let the reader understand!

Professor David Watts,
Alexander von Humboldt Laureate, University of Manchester;
